Job Description
As the office manager and Executive Admin at our Bird-Johnson Propeller Naval Marine site in Walpole, MA you will have the opportunity to positively impact the daily lives of all 150+ employees at our site. This role will interact across all functions and coordinate site activities. A proactive problem solver in a team environment that is a self-starter will excel here.
KeyAccountabilities
- Provide Exec Admin support to the Bird-Johnson President and leadership team, including calendar management and arranging travel.
- Coordinate and support large customer meetings at the site.
- Manage site visitors with site security in compliance with company policy, organize meeting needs and refreshments where necessary.
- Support Human Resources and function managers with new employee onboarding.
- Manage inventory and order supplies for the site.
- Support office upkeep, photocopying, faxing, mail distribution and filing as appropriate.
- Draft and send sitewide communications on behalf of the functional teams.
- Assist with coordination of site engagement activities and projects as assigned.
- Anticipate the needs of the business.
- High School Diploma & 2 years relevant experience
- Must be proficient in Microsoft Office Products, Word, Powerpoint, Outlook etc.
- Must be able to work most of core business hours on site. Remote work can be supported on an ad‑hoc approved basis.
- Customer service orientated mentality – must be able to represent senior management professionally with external visitors, as well as support interior office team needs.
- Able to multitask and work with service providers.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Professional interpersonal skills.
- Experience of organizing sitewide events when needed.
- Previous experience as an Office Administrator or event planning
- Previous experience working with Senior Level Managers
